// Fan-out cap for StormPing weather alerts. Don't raise this
// casually — past 500 per batch the Kestrel push gateway starts
// dropping acks and we double-send warnings, which freaks people
// out during actual storms. If you think you need more throughput,
// add batches, not a bigger cap. This value was last validated
// against the build noted below.

pipeline stamp: htk3_a71

## Tuning

The QuillPress invoice renderer exposes several knobs that directly affect throughput and memory footprint. Raising the page-raster concurrency improves batch latency but increases peak RSS roughly linearly, so coordinate changes with the capacity plan before the weekly deploy. Font-cache size matters most for multilingual invoices; undersizing it causes repeated glyph shaping and a visible CPU spike. We validated the defaults against the Harrowgate staging corpus last sprint. The current recommended constants are as follows.

tuning table, yajog-yahof:
BUDGETS = {
    "lamvan": 303,
    "wenox": 460,
    "fenvan": 525,
}

The residual from banker's rounding is accumulated in a per-batch drift counter; if drift exceeds the alert threshold, the reconciliation job in the Tollgate cluster pages on-call rather than silently absorbing the difference. Most pages resolve by re-running the batch with a wider scale. Before adjusting anything, check the current tuning constants, which are reproduced below for quick reference during an incident.

tuning table, hafog-bahaf:
QUOTAS = {
    "praion": 144,
    "briax": 906,
    "silwyn": 451,
}

Fan-out backpressure for the Quillet notifier: when the queue depth crosses the soft limit, the dispatcher sheds low-priority pushes and batches the rest at 500ms intervals. Reviewer should confirm the shed counter is exported and that retries respect the jitter window. Once merged, the release artifact gets re-signed by the pipeline, which expects the deploy key shown below.

deploy key for bawep-yawif: bky6_GQhaSt